Mega-yacht with 400 passengers crashes into New York City dock, injuring nearly a dozen
Nearly a dozen people were injured on Saturday after a mega-yacht carrying hundreds of people struck a dock on the Hudson River in Manhattan, New York.Just after 4:15 p.m., the New York City Fire Department (FDNY) received a call for a yacht with about 400 people on board that struck a dock at 130thStreet and the Hudson River, Fox News learned.MASSIVE SAILING VESSEL COLLIDES WITH BROOKLYN BRIDGE IN DRAMATIC NYC CRASH CAUGHT ON CAMERANine people were taken to local hospitals with minor injuries, according to FDNY officials.No fatalities have been confirmed.MORE THAN 20 PEOPLE INJURED AFTER BOAT CATCHES FIRE IN NEW YORK; CAPTAIN CHARGED WITH DWIThe fire department towed the party yacht to a southern boat dock at 125thStreet, though its current condition is unknown.NYC Mayor Eric Adams had not yet publicly commented on the incident, as of 6:05 p.m.Breaking news.
